Warehouse given less than 12 months

Post PNG Ltd’s chief executive officer, Justin Worinu, emphasized that the new warehouse, storage and distribution facility at Motukea will have to be delivered in less than 12 months.

He shared that it was a lengthy and tough process to secure funds from Kumul Consolidated Holdings (KCH), however, the funds were secured for the project eventually and with three contractors on board as well the task should be delivered within the time frame.

“It was not easy to secure funding from KCH with the lengthy criteria and requirements through the board and to KCH. It was very tough and lengthy but you guys made it through, you have secured this project as the bidders and you got it on merit so we need to deliver this project,” Worinu said.

“For the three contractors that are on this project, our job starts today, and tomorrow we will get our hands dirty. This is a big task and we’ve got three big portions here two of the portions will be for the construction of the warehouse.”
